Is throwed correct?

Is throwed correct?

(nonstandard, dialectal) Simple past tense of throw; threw. (nonstandard, dialectal) Past participle of thro; thrown.

Through is a preposition and an adverb. (It can also be used as an adjective). Threw is the past tense of ‘throw’. The past participle is thrown.

What is the participle form of the verb throw?

Furthermore, to be more clear, a participle expresses completed action and that is one of the principal parts of the verb. The five forms of throw are: throw, throws, threw, thrown, throwing.
